01 · Context

What I owned

I worked as the only designer and built consistency at scale while shipping quickly. The mandate was to improve operator efficiency, keep engineering aligned to existing data structures, and deliver production-ready workflows without slowing platform evolution.

01

Design system from zero

I established foundations, reusable patterns, and interaction standards used across product teams.

02

Main platform redesign

I redesigned the core data management platform for microclimate and industrial conditioning workflows.

03

Workflow automation for HVAC technicians

I adapted connected chillers flows to field technicians, based on onsite observations and real equipment behavior.

04

Fast delivery on existing data models

I shipped within legacy data constraints, balancing speed, adoption, and operational clarity.

03 · Delivery Constraints

Designing with legacy data and speed constraints

Constraint

Existing structures could not be replaced. Flows had to map to current objects, relationships, and service boundaries.

Response

I treated information architecture and interaction states as the leverage point, so we could ship faster without refactoring core models first.
